مرجع تخصصی برنامه نویسان

انجمن تخصصی برنامه نویسان فارسی زبان

کاربر سایت

محمدحسین فخرآوری

عضویت از 1393/04/06

Upload Center Files

  • دوشنبه 7 آبان 1397
  • 07:46
تشکر میکنم

سلام میخواهم فایل در ftp اپلود کنم و همزمان با یک روش کد گذاری کنم. و قابلیت رمز گشایی فایل در زمان دانلود باشه. حالا سوال اینجاست که چون ما فایل در ftp ذخیره میکنیم برای کد کردن مشکلی نیست و ذخیره میکنیم در ftp ولی در زمان رمز گشایی باید به همان حجم در سمت سرور دانلود بشه و الگورریتم کد گزاری روش اعمال بشه تا فایل سالم تولید بشه. ایا روش بهتری هست؟

پاسخ های این پرسش

تعداد پاسخ ها : 2 پاسخ
کاربر سایت

AmirGhasemi

عضویت از 1392/02/25

  • چهارشنبه 9 آبان 1397
  • 07:44

با سلام

بنده بطور دقیق اطلاع ندارم که شما دقیقا چه هدف و اکشنی رو بیزینس خود دارید اما در حوزه رمزنگاری قائل به این هستم که معمولا دیتا بهنگام ذخیره سازی در سمت سرور وقتی بصورت رمز ذخیره شد پس در طول مسیر انتقال نیز باید به صورت رمز منتقل شده و در سمت کلاینت بصورت کشف، برگردد.

پس به نظر بنده وقتی شما می خواهید که در سمت سرور دوباره ان را از حالت رمز خارج کنید در واقع یک تسلسل باطل ایجاد کرده اید و به ان فایل در طول مسیر انقال می توان دست یافت.

به نظر بنده کلیدهای رمز را در اختیار کلاینت قرار دهید و پس از دانلود در سمت کلاینت عملیات کشف، صورت گیرد.

تکنیک ها و الگویتم های استاندارد جهانی برای این اقدام، موجود می باشد.

کاربر سایت

محمدحسین فخرآوری

عضویت از 1393/04/06

  • چهارشنبه 9 آبان 1397
  • 08:20

سلام

در مورد کاری که میخواهم انجام بدهم بگم

من یک فایل ساده اپلود میکنم و با یک روش فایل encod و ذخیره میکنم. و این فایل تا زمانی که decode نشه قابل باز شدن نیست.

فقط سوال من اینجاست که اگر فایل در سرور سیو کنیم و decode کنیم چون مکان فیزیکی فایل خود سرور هست سرعت خواندن و تبدیل کردن بالا هست.

ولی اگه محل ذخیره ftp باشد. فرایند تبدیل به decode زمان بر هست، چون باید بره فایل از ftp دانلود کند و به byte تبدیل کند و الگوریتم decode روش پیاده کند

کاربرانی که از این پست تشکر کرده اند

هیچ کاربری تا کنون از این پست تشکر نکرده است

اگر نیاز به یک مشاور در زمینه طراحی سایت ، برنامه نویسی و بازاریابی الکترونیکی دارید

با ما تماس بگیرید تا در این مسیر همراهتان باشیم :)